Reddit seeding via value-first posts

Publish genuinely useful posts tailored to a subreddit, then offer your product as an optional tool rather than the point of the post.

common tacticfree budget

Why this can grow a startup

Subreddits punish promotion but reward utility, so the best distribution comes from helping first.

When to use it

Use this when Reddit is relevant to 0-100, 100-1K and you can run a bounded test with a free budget.

When not to use it

Do not use it as a substitute for customer evidence, a clear owner, or a measurable stop condition. Local platform rules and market behavior still need checking.

Founder checklist

  1. Read reddit.com and identify what is directly supported.
  2. Choose one channel context: Reddit.
  3. Define the test around one observable customer behavior.
  4. Set an owner, evidence window, and stop condition before launch.
